Webinar Series | Child Protection in West and Central Africa
The Alliance for Child Protection in Humanitarian Action is excited to announce a French-language webinar series focused on locally-led NGO programming in West and Central Africa. This series provides a unique platform to explore current achievements and challenges in the region, while offering valuable insights into ongoing programs. Conducted entirely in French, the webinars aim to foster meaningful discussions and collaboration among participants.
